Types of Pneumatic Conveying Equipment Used in Industrial Automation

There are two primary categories of pneumatic conveying technology: dilute phase conveying and dense phase conveying systems. Dilute phase systems move materials at high velocity using lower pressure, making them suitable for lightweight powders and non-fragile products. Dense phase pneumatic conveyors, on the other hand, transport materials at lower velocities and higher pressures, reducing product degradation and pipeline wear.

Many industrial facilities integrate vacuum conveying systems for hygienic applications such as pharmaceutical powder transfer and food-grade ingredient handling. Pressure conveying systems are widely used in cement plants, chemical processing facilities, and plastic resin transport operations. Key Industries Using Pneumatic Conveying Technology

The demand for industrial conveying systems continues to rise across multiple high-value industries. In the food manufacturing sector, pneumatic conveying machinery is used for flour transfer, sugar handling, spice processing, and dairy powder transportation. Pharmaceutical companies rely on sanitary conveying systems for contamination-free ingredient transfer and regulatory compliance.

Chemical processing plants use heavy-duty pneumatic conveyors to move hazardous powders and industrial compounds safely. Similarly, the cement and construction industries depend on bulk powder conveying systems for efficient transport of fly ash, lime, and cement materials. Plastic manufacturing companies also invest heavily in resin conveying systems and automated pellet transfer technology to streamline production lines and reduce manual handling.
